About Ahoy the Movie (1997) — A Swashbuckling Adventure for All Ages
Step into the world of swashbuckling adventure with Ahoy the Movie (1997), a quirky animation that will leave you hooked. Directed by Bruce Pukema, this short film tells the tale of a crusty old pirate trying to outdo a young sailor with scary sea stories. But when the youngster goes too far, the pirates take their revenge in a hilarious and action-packed sequence.
